Output 67d94c00ac70d76b5411826e11976f106f0bec55ca687da048e030e69e8d766f:1

value
589520
script pubkey
OP_0 OP_PUSHBYTES_20 30d4cba81d3cea621995a45e05f6f58ea74a01d0
address
ltc1qxr2vh2qa8n4xyxv4530qtah436n55qwsfah24y
transaction
67d94c00ac70d76b5411826e11976f106f0bec55ca687da048e030e69e8d766f
spent
true